Shelter Installation in Conroe, TX
Shelter installation services encompass the setup of structures designed to provide protection and functional space on residential properties. These projects can include installing carports, patio covers, awnings, pergolas, and other covered structures that enhance outdoor living areas or offer shelter for vehicles and equipment. Property owners typically seek these services to improve their property's usability, increase shade, or create a designated space for outdoor activities, all while ensuring the structures are properly supported and durable.
Before requesting shelter installation, homeowners should consider factors such as the intended purpose of the structure, available space, local building codes, and aesthetic preferences. Understanding the desired size, materials, and placement can help ensure the project aligns with property needs and budget. Additionally, property owners often want to know about the process involved, including preparation requirements and any necessary permits, to plan accordingly for a smooth installation experience.

Shelter Installation Questions
What types of shelters can be installed? Shelters such as carports, awnings, and pergolas are commonly installed to provide protection and enhance outdoor spaces.
What should property owners consider before installation? It’s important to evaluate the space, intended use, and compatibility with existing structures to ensure proper fit and function.
Are there specific materials used for shelter installations? Common materials include metal, wood, and polycarbonate, chosen for durability and suitability to the environment.
What is the purpose of shelter installation? Shelters are installed to offer shade, weather protection, or to improve outdoor aesthetics and usability.
